Jimmie Smith Life and Times

Jimmie Lee Smith, affectionately known as Big Jim or Jimmie Lee, was born on July 3, 1941, in the Newtown Community of Union Springs, AL, to the late Daisy Lindsey and Jim Smith. Following his mother's early passing, he was lovingly raised by his step-mother, the late Armillar Smith, alongside his father. 

Jimmie Lee peacefully transitioned at his residence in Brundidge, AL, on Thursday, March 21, 2024, at the age of 82. Commemoration of life services will be held on Saturday, March 30, 2024, 2:00 p.m., at Bullock County Career Technical Center in Union Springs, AL. Words of comfort will be delivered by Rev. Tommy Cooper, Sr., Pastor of Morning Star Missionary Baptist Church, Union Springs, AL. 

Jimmie Lee found solace in his faith early on and became a member of Morning Star Missionary Baptist Church in Union Springs. He received his education from the Bullock County School System and dedicated his working years to construction until his well-deserved retirement. Known for his joyful spirit, he delighted in creating cherished memories with family and friends. In his later years, he settled in Troy, AL, before retiring in Brundidge, AL.
